Output 7636427c934afc3e95944f3bb214b172d3674eb3524e5aa784d19a68adf9ac29:3

value
77732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85be86fa625eafb30a18e8be83b89f53a8c76c7 OP_EQUAL
address
3H3DYeXZvBUVRDjGPz3zExUQLcz5PaxMKu
transaction
7636427c934afc3e95944f3bb214b172d3674eb3524e5aa784d19a68adf9ac29